PRO-MIX® CCX AGTIV REACH®

100% Coco - High Water Retention

Optimizes cannabis crop growth and minimizes nutrient and water loss​. This premium coir blend offers the ideal water retention and air circulation combination, fostering optimal plant growth conditions.

Ideal for high-water retention and a perfect mix for cannabis growers aiming for better yields, with AGTIV REACH® mycorrhizae to support stronger root systems and improved nutrient uptake.

Ingredients
Inert ingredients

Coir - chunk, Coir - pith

Active ingredients

AGTIV REACH® : Mycorrhizae

Specifications

Stable pH

5.5-7.0

Low EC

0.7 <mmhos/cm

Water Holding Capacity

70-75%

Science at the Root of Growth

Thanks to mycorrhizae, AGTIV REACH® promotes the development of a more extensive root system, allowing plants to access more water and nutrients. The result is increased growth, along with more robust and vigorous plants. An essential tool for maximizing crop potential and achieving superior results.

Organic Materials Review Institute (OMRI)

The Organic Materials Review Institute (OMRI) supports organic integrity by providing organic certifiers, growers, manufacturers, and suppliers an independent review of products intended for use in certified organic production, handling, and processing.
